Bambu Lab Teases the R1 Standalone Laser
On August 13 Bambu opened a teaser page for the R1, its first standalone laser engraver and cutter, marked "Coming September." After laser modules inside the H2D, the R1 is a dedicated machine. Few specs are confirmed, so treat leaked spec sheets with caution until the official reveal.
Bambu Confirms Consumer UV Printing R&D
Chinese tech outlet 21Tech reported on August 19 that Bambu has moved from exploration to full-scale R&D on a consumer UV printer, with a reported 2027 target. UV printing deposits curable ink or resin onto flat surfaces. If Bambu applies its onboarding playbook, the consumer UV category could shift the same way consumer FDM did in 2022.
Polymaker Breaks PLA's Heat Ceiling
Polymaker launched HT-PLA Pro, a heat-stable PLA that maintains the easy printing of PLA while delivering:
| Metric | HT-PLA Pro | Standard HT-PLA |
|---|---|---|
| Vicat softening point | ~150 °C | ~115 °C |
| Notched impact strength | ~9.9 kJ/m² | ~4.9 kJ/m² |
| Layer adhesion | +30% vs prior | — |
| Printing profile | PLA-easy, no enclosure | PLA-easy |
